The Enduring Appeal of Granite

Before exploring design matching, it helps to understand why granite remains a top choice for kitchens. Granite forms from molten rock deep within the earth, shaped under intense heat and pressure. This natural process gives it exceptional strength and resistance to scratches, heat, and daily wear. These qualities make granite an ideal surface for the demands of a busy kitchen.

Beyond its strength, granite offers natural artistry that cannot be replicated. Each slab is unique, with its own veining, speckles, and color variations. This ensures your kitchen has a one-of-a-kind elegance that synthetic materials cannot match. Granite is also easy to maintain. Regular cleaning with mild soap and water, along with occasional sealing, protects it from stains.

The Dynamic Duo: Countertops and Backsplashes

While countertops are undoubtedly the workhorses of the kitchen, backsplashes are the unsung heroes that tie the entire design together. Functionally, backsplashes protect your walls from splashes and spills, especially around the sink and cooking areas. Aesthetically, they provide an opportunity to introduce color, texture, and pattern, complementing or contrasting with your countertops to create visual interest.

When pairing granite countertops with backsplashes, the goal is to achieve a harmonious balance. This doesn't necessarily mean matching them perfectly, but rather ensuring they work together to create a cohesive and appealing space.

Finding Your Kitchen's Personality: Design Styles and Granite Choices

  1. Modern & Contemporary Kitchens


Modern kitchens often embrace clean lines, minimalist aesthetics, and a focus on functionality. For this style, consider granite with a more uniform, subtle pattern or a solid appearance.

  • Countertops:
    • Absolute Black: This timeless classic offers a sleek, sophisticated look, providing a dramatic contrast with lighter cabinetry or a seamless flow with darker tones.
    • Black Galaxy: Tiny flecks of shimmering copper or gold on a deep black background add subtle sparkle without overwhelming the minimalist aesthetic.
    • White Granite (e.g., White Ice, River White): These granites offer a bright, airy feel, often featuring delicate grey or black veining that complements a contemporary palette.
  • Backsplashes:


    • Matching Granite: For a truly seamless and monolithic look, extend your countertop granite up the wall as a full-height backsplash. This creates a luxurious and expansive feel.
    • Subway Tile (White or Grey): Classic subway tiles, laid in a stacked or offset pattern, offer a clean and timeless backdrop that allows the granite to be the focal point.
    • Glass Tile: Glass tiles in solid colors or subtle patterns can add a touch of sheen and modernity.
    • Stainless Steel: For an ultra-modern, industrial edge, a stainless steel backsplash can be a striking choice, especially when paired with black or grey granite.
  1. Traditional & Classic Kitchens


    Countertop Options for Traditional Kitchens:

    • Brown/Beige Granites (e.g., Tan Brown, Giallo Ornamental, Santa Cecilia): These warm-toned granites feature intricate patterns of browns, creams, and golds. They create a rich, inviting look and pair beautifully with cream, white, or wood-toned cabinets.

    • Green Granites (e.g., Ubatuba, Verde Butterfly): Green granites add depth and subtle luxury. They work especially well with cherry or dark wood cabinetry.

    • Burgundy/Red Granites (e.g., Tropical Brown, Bordeaux): Bold and dramatic, these granites make excellent focal points in larger kitchens with plenty of natural light.

  • Backsplashes:


    •  Travertine or Marble Tile: These natural stones add elegance and sophistication. A tumbled or honed finish softens the look.
    • Decorative Ceramic or Porcelain Tile: Intricate patterns, mosaics, or hand-painted tiles introduce an artisanal, historical feel.

    • Subway Tile (Cream or Off-White): A classic choice that provides subtle texture without overpowering ornate elements.

    • Brick Veneer: Adds warmth and rustic charm, perfect for a traditional aesthetic.

  1. Farmhouse & Rustic Kitchens


    Farmhouse kitchens radiate comfort, warmth, and a connection to nature. They often showcase natural materials, distressed finishes, and a relaxed, lived-in charm.

    Countertops:

    • Light Granites with Speckles (e.g., New Venetian Gold, Imperial White): These granites bring rustic appeal. Flecks of black, brown, and gold mimic natural imperfections.

    • Honed or Leathered Finish: Instead of polished granite, consider a honed (matte) or leathered (textured) finish. It reduces reflections and enhances the stone's natural, rustic feel.

    • Grey Granites with Earthy Tones: Grey granites with subtle brown or beige undertones blend seamlessly into a farmhouse aesthetic, offering understated elegance.

  • Backsplashes:


  • Subway Tile (White, Cream, or Light Grey): Simple subway tiles, especially with a slightly uneven or handmade finish, enhance the relaxed farmhouse vibe.

  • Shiplap: For a classic farmhouse look, extend shiplap from the countertop to the ceiling. It creates a cohesive, rustic backdrop.

  • Exposed Brick: Revealing existing brick or adding brick veneer instantly adds rustic charm and character.

  • Zellige Tile: Handmade clay tiles with varied textures and glazes provide an artisanal, organic feel, perfect for farmhouse kitchens.
